FUNERAL OF ARCHBISHOP IGNACY TOKARCZUK

On 2 January 2013 in the arch-cathedral of Przemyśl there were funeral celebrations of archbishop Ignacy Tokarczuk, the 67th bishop of Przemyśl and the first metropolitan of Przemyśl, who was administering the diocese in the years 1965-93, and he gained the name of ‘bishop steadfast’ for his activity during the period the Polish People’s Republic. The apostolic nuncio archbishop Celestino Migliore read out a telegram from the Holy Father Benedict XVI. ‘A prominent pastor went away to God, who cared about believers entrusted to him, with love. »

HOW TO WIN THE BATTLE OF VIENNA

ANNA WYSZYŃSKA

The picture of Jan Matejko ‘Jan Sobieski at Vienna’ is going to have its replica. However, it is not going to be a painted but embroidered copy. The task was undertaken by a group of volunteers which is run by Mrs Janina Panek from Działoszyn. Careful readers of the ‘Sunday’ are familiar with her surname. Indeed, it is the same person who in the year 2010 initiated the embroidering the picture ‘Battle at Vienna’ about which the ‘Sunday’ has written a few times. »
